Output 962976618f89b14c6b855c689e25a54248210be7c1d768a3a5b0fd19dd1662b2:1

value
499420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bddce1db77593a7ac8d67f0d488c4311d5103ffa OP_EQUAL
address
3JzvEy64J63pDv7KjyKsVzupMgKcwdgQU4
transaction
962976618f89b14c6b855c689e25a54248210be7c1d768a3a5b0fd19dd1662b2
spent
true